UNCHAINED - Powerful & Unflinching Narratives Of Former Slaves: 28 True Life Stories in One Volume : Journey to Freedom: Unyielding Slavery Narratives

This unique collection consists of the most influential narratives of former slaves and the stories of people who have helped them. With their powerful & unflinching stories, they changed people's convictions and shook the very foundation of slavery:

Narrative of the Life of Frederick Douglass

12 Years a Slave by Solomon Northup

The Underground Railroad

The Willie Lynch Letter: The Making of Slave!

Confessions of Nat Turner

Narrative of Sojourner Truth

Incidents in the Life of a Slave Girl, by Harriet Jacobs

Harriet: The Moses of Her People

History of Mary Prince

Running a Thousand Miles for Freedom, by William and Ellen Craft

Thirty Years a Slave: From Bondage to Freedom, by Louis Hughes

Narrative of the Life of J. D. Green, a Runaway Slave

Up From Slavery by Booker T. Washington

Narrative of Olaudah Equiano

Behind The Scenes - 30 Years a Slave & 4 Years in the White House, by Elizabeth Keckley

Father Henson's Story of His Own Life

Fifty Years in Chains, by Charles Ball

Twenty-Two Years a Slave and Forty Years a Freeman, by Austin Steward

Narrative of the Life of Henry Bibb

Narrative of William W. Brown, a Fugitive Slave

Story of Mattie J. Jackson

A Slave Girl's Story, by Kate Drumgoold

From the Darkness Cometh the Light, by Lucy A. Delaney

Narrative of the Life of Moses Grandy

Narrative of Joanna; An Emancipated Slave, of Surinam

Narrative of the Life of Henry Box Brown, Who Escaped in a 3x2 Feet Box

Memoir and Poems of Phillis Wheatley

Buried Alive For a Quarter of a Century - Life of William Walker

Pictures of Slavery in Church and State

Dying Speech of Stephen Smith Who Was Executed for Burglary

Life of Joseph Mountain

Charge of Aiding and Abetting in the Rescue of a Fugitive Slave

Lynch Law in All Its Phases

Duty of Disobedience to the Fugitive Slave Act

Captain Canot

Pearl Incident: Personal Memoir of Daniel Drayton

History of Abolition of African Slave-Trade

History of American Abolitionism
